YAGEO Group competitors & alternatives

YAGEO Group is a leading global provider of passive electronic components, including resistors, capacitors, and inductors, serving diverse industries from automotive to telecommunications. Top YAGEO Group competitors

YAGEO Group competitors include Murata, TDK, Vishay Intertechnology, Samsung Electro-Mechanics and KYOCERA AVX.

Murata

Passive Component ManufacturerEnterprise

Murata competes with YAGEO Group in the global passive component market, specifically in ceramic capacitors. While YAGEO focuses on a broad portfolio of resistors and capacitors, Murata differentiates itself through advanced material science and high-frequency module integration, making it a preferred choice for complex, miniaturized consumer electronics and automotive applications.

TDK

Electronic Materials and ComponentsEnterprise

TDK competes with YAGEO Group in the supply of capacitors and inductive components. While YAGEO leverages a highly efficient manufacturing model for standard components, TDK differentiates through its deep expertise in magnetic materials and battery technology. This makes TDK a stronger alternative for projects requiring advanced energy storage and sensor integration.

Vishay Intertechnology

Discrete Semiconductor ManufacturerEnterprise

Vishay competes with YAGEO Group in the industrial and automotive resistor segments. Unlike YAGEO, which emphasizes high-volume commodity passive components, Vishay offers a more extensive range of power semiconductors and specialized sensors. Buyers often choose Vishay when they require a single-source supplier for both passive components and power management solutions.

Samsung Electro-Mechanics

High-Tech Component ManufacturerEnterprise

Samsung Electro-Mechanics competes with YAGEO Group in the MLCC market. While YAGEO maintains a strong position in the general-purpose resistor and capacitor space, Samsung leverages its massive internal R&D capabilities to lead in high-capacitance, ultra-small form factor components, offering a distinct advantage for high-end smartphone and mobile device manufacturers.

KYOCERA AVX

Passive Electronic ComponentsEnterprise

AVX competes with YAGEO Group in the capacitor and connector markets. Unlike YAGEO's focus on high-volume resistor production, AVX provides specialized high-reliability components for aerospace and medical sectors. Buyers often switch to AVX when their design requirements demand extreme temperature tolerance and rigorous compliance standards beyond standard industrial-grade passive components.

Market overview

The passive component market is highly competitive, with manufacturers differentiating through material science, production scale, and specialized application expertise. Decision factors for buyers include supply chain stability, component miniaturization capabilities, and the ability to meet stringent automotive or industrial compliance standards.

Why users choose YAGEO Group

  • Extensive global distribution network
  • Strong focus on high-volume commodity components
  • Competitive pricing for standard passive parts
  • Broad portfolio covering resistors, capacitors, and inductors

Why users switch to alternatives

  • Need for specialized high-frequency modules
  • Requirement for integrated power semiconductor solutions
  • Demand for extreme-environment aerospace-grade components
  • Preference for advanced battery and sensor technology integration
